Know Before You Go

Gatherings are free and open to children of all ages and people in all stages of parenthood, from pregnancy and beyond.  There is no sign-up, but we do ask that folks sign-in upon arrival. 

During the rainy season, we gather at the Brentwood Darlington Community Center, there is a small parking lot on site, or plenty of street parking. Please bring a vessel for tea.

Gatherings start at 9:30 and end at 11:30. You may come and go as you please, there is no hard start time. But we do have set times for our workshops - see our calendar. And we ask that folks respect the end time of 11:30, as the community center space needs to transition to other use at 12.

During the dry season. we meet at the Green Thumb Community Orchard; please park on 57th and enter through the orchard gate at the north end of the site. Please bring a vessel for tea, a blanket, snacks, and anything you need to keep you and your family comfortable.  As a part of community care, feel free to sign up to offer snacks or help set up or break down here

Gathering and Workshop News: January 2023

Partum Gardens is excited to implement a few things this season for the growth and sustainability of this community.

First off, the weekly gathering will always and forever remain a free offering. We will continue to facilitate the space with intention, tea, and bodywork, as well as share weekly garden gifts and tasks along with seasonal herbal wisdom. 

We will continue to incorporate workshops into our weekly gatherings 2x/month. We are also happy to announce that we will begin a monthly weekend workshop! Workshops will differ from the gathering wellness activities (tea, bodywork, etc) in that participants will take home the garden and herbal products.

We will implement a sliding scale fee for our workshops starting February 1, 2023. We see this fee as a reciprocal exchange of energy that will help to sustain and improve the quality of the workshops. It will also help us cover the costs associated with providing the workshops, such as materials and equipment.  No one will be turned away for lack of funds, we will offer alternative options such as scholarships or reduced fee for those who cannot afford it.

We value your support and are always open to feedback, thanks for helping Partum Gardens continue to grow into a healing and supportive space for birthing bodies and our families.
